Problems solved by technology

In the time-division synchronous code division multiple access technology TD-SCDMA system, the uplink and downlink time slot switching points are variable, if the practice of using 5 bits to fix the indication will cause waste of information bits, in some time slot configurations Under the structure, the efficiency of signaling transmission will decrease, resulting in waste of transmission resources and increasing the transmission load of control information.

no. 1 example

[0040] In this embodiment, the system configures a fixed number of N bits of time slot occupation information indication bits in the time slot resource occupation indication information structure of the HS-SCCH channel. Such as figure 2 As shown, in this embodiment, N=5, and the 5-bit information is transmitted to one UE, but the system can simultaneously send different time slot occupancy information to multiple UEs. When the bit corresponds to a certain time slot, if the value is 1, it means that the time slot is occupied; if the value is 0, it means that the time slot is not occupied, and of course the opposite is also possible. Alternatively, this bit may be invalid, ie not indicate the occupancy status of any slot.

[0041] The method for dynamic indication of time slot occupation in this embodiment includes the following steps:

no. 2 example

[0062] In this embodiment, the HS-SCCH channel adopts a variable-length time slot resource occupancy indication information structure, and the time slot occupancy dynamic indication method includes the following steps:

[0063] Step A: Set the length of the HS-SCCH channel time slot resource occupancy indication structure under each combination of uplink and downlink time slot configuration structure information and the number of carriers, and each possible occupied downlink time slot in this structure In the corresponding information bit, save the dynamic association relationship in NodeB and UE;

[0064] In this embodiment, the length of the HS-SCCH channel time slot resource occupancy indication structure is equal to the number of configured downlink time slots, and each information bit corresponds to one downlink time slot in turn.

Abstract

The invention discloses a method for a dynamic indicating high speed downlink grouping access time slot occupation which is applied to a multicarrier TDD system. Firstly, with the combination of each uplink and downlink time slot allocation structure information and carrier number prearranged, a corresponding information bit indicating manner of each downlink time slot occupied condition in an HS-SCCH channel time slot resource occupation indicating structure is saved at a node B and a mobile terminal UE; the uplink and downlink time slots allocation structure and the carried number information of the district are obtained by the node B and the UE; after the HS-SCCH code track resource is distributed by the node B to a UE, the corresponding information bit value of the information structure is arranged according to the downlink time slot occupation condition; the information of the structure and the carrier number is allocated by the UE according to the uplink and downlink time slot resource, and the corresponding information bit indicating manner in the downlink time slot occupation condition is ensured; the downlink time slot occupation condition is obtained according to the corresponding information bit value. The method for the dynamic indicating high speed downlink grouping access time slot occupation can indicate the occupation condition of a TSO time slot and improve the service efficiency of the time slot occupation indicating information.

Description

technical field [0001] The invention relates to a dynamic indication method for time slot occupation of high-speed downlink packet access, in particular to a dynamic indication method for time slot occupation of a multi-carrier high-speed downlink packet access system in the communication field. Background technique [0002] 3GPP (Third Generation Collaborative Project Organization) introduced the high-speed downlink packet access (HSDPA: Highspeed oownlink PacketAccess) feature in Releases 5 of the 3G (third-generation mobile communication technology) specification, with the purpose of providing higher-speed downlink packet services , to increase the downlink capacity. Based on the UMTS (Universal Mobile Telecommunications System) R4 architecture, HSDPA achieves the above goals by introducing technologies such as Adaptive Modulation and Coding (AMC) and Hybrid Automatic Retransmission Request (HARQ).
